[QUOTE="Xath, post: 2085905, member: 17040"] I've been working on some new staves. In some battle situations, Cure Serious Wounds just takes too long. I think we may want to invest in a faster, more efficient Staff of Healing. Thus, I give you: [B]Healing (Greater): [/B] This white ash staff, with inlaid golden runes, allows use of the following spells: [list] [*][I]Heal[/I] (1 charge) [*][I]Cure Critical Wounds[/I] (1 charge) [*][I]Remove Curse[/I] (1 charge) [/list] Strong Conjunction; CL 15th; Craft Staff, [I]heal, cure critical wounds, remove curse[/I]; Price 59063gp Or, we can reduce the cost by increasing the charges (which I think is reasonable) [B]Healing (Greater): [/B] This white ash staff, with inlaid golden runes, allows use of the following spells: [list] [*][I]Heal[/I] (2 charges) [*][I]Cure Critical Wounds[/I] (2 charges) [*][I]Remove Curse[/I] (2 charges) [/list] Strong Conjunction; CL 15th; Craft Staff, [I]heal, cure critical wounds, remove curse[/I]; Price 29531gp I think Heal is a really good spell to have. With just one casting from a 15th level staff, someone can be healed 150pts of damage in 1 round. Wheras now, we wait for a song, or we cast Cure Serious, which cures an average of 17 pts of damage a round. In some of our current combats, with the amount of damage we take, I think ready access to some serious healing would come in handy. More staves to come! Same bat time, same bat channel... [/QUOTE]
